#056424 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#056424 is composed of 2% red, 39.2%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95% cyan, 0% magenta, 64%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 139.6 degrees, a saturation of 90.5% and a lightness of 20.6%. #056424 color hex could be obtained by blending #0ac848 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

● #056424 color description : Very dark cyan - lime green.
#056424 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#056424 has RGB values of R:5, G:100,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 353316.
